      Winter Harp caps of an 11-city tour across Western Canada with a performance at St. Andrew’s-Wesley United Church (1012 Nelson Street) on Saturday (December 22) at 7:30 p.m. The holiday tradition, now in its 19th year on tour, features special guest Kim Robertson, one of the world’s leading Celtic harpists.

      Clad in medieval attire, the Winter Harp musicians will perform a mix of popular Christmas carols, Celtic songs, and medieval, world, and Spanish tunes. The band will include classical harps, drums, tambourines, temple bells, flutes, and an assortment of rare medieval instruments, including the bass psaltery, the organistrum, and the Swedish nyckelharpa.

      Along with Robertson, this year’s Winter Harp ensemble includes Janelle Nadeau, Roger Helfrik, Lauri Lyster, Jeff Pelletier, Joaquin Ayala, and Lori Pappajohn.
